What is an Oven?
An oven is an enclosed area developed for heating and cooking food, providing various techniques such as baking, roasting, and broiling. Ovens can be found in different types, each serving distinct cooking choices and requirements.
Types of Ovens
Conventional Ovens:
- Use gas or electrical power for heating.
- Normally include a heating element at the top and bottom.
- Suitable for hob standard baking tasks.
Convection Ovens:
- Use a fan to distribute hot air, promoting even cooking.
- Suitable for baking, roasting, and reheating.
- Minimizes cooking time and enhances flavor.
Steam Ovens:
- Utilize steam to prepare food while retaining wetness and nutrients.
- Exceptional for health-conscious cooking, such as veggies and fish.
Microwave Ovens:
- Use electromagnetic radiation to heat food rapidly.
- best oven uk for reheating leftovers or cooking easy meals.
Wall Ovens:
- Built into the wall, saving space in the kitchen.
- Available in various configurations, consisting of single or double ovens.

What is a Hob?
A hob is a cooking surface, frequently referred to as a stove or cooktop, where cookware is placed for heating. hobs and ovens are available in various products, sizes, and heating techniques, accommodating varied cooking needs.
Types of Hobs
Gas Hobs:
- Utilize gas burners for direct flame cooking.
- Deal exact temperature control and are favored by many professional chefs.
Electric Hobs:
- Use electric coils or smooth tops.
- Some designs are geared up with induction innovation, supplying quick heating through electro-magnetic energy.
Induction Hobs:
- Cookware must be made from magnetic products.
- Very energy-efficient, supplying fast heat and decreasing burn dangers.
Ceramic Hobs:
- Feature a glass-ceramic surface area with heating components underneath.
- Easy to tidy but can be less energy-efficient than induction hobs.

Maintenance Tips for Ovens and Hobs
Appropriate care and upkeep of your cooking devices extend their life expectancy and efficiency. Here are vital maintenance pointers:
Regular Cleaning:
- Clean the oven interior after each use to prevent residue buildup.
- Wipe down hob surface areas after cooking to prevent discolorations.
Check Seals:
- Ensure the oven door seals are intact to preserve energy efficiency.
- Change damaged gaskets and seals as required.
Examine Burners and Elements:
- For gas hobs, look for obstructions in burners.
- For electric hobs, check coils and surfaces for indications of wear.
FAQs
Can I utilize any cookware on induction hobs?
- No, induction hobs only work with magnetic cookware, such as cast iron or stainless-steel.
What is the most energy-efficient cooking appliance?
- Induction hobs are normally the most energy-efficient option, utilizing less energy than traditional gas or electric designs.
